Understanding IBS-D and the Importance of Dietary Management



What is IBS-D?


Irritable Bowel Syndrome with Diarrhea (IBS-D) is a common functional gastrointestinal disorder characterized by chronic or recurrent episodes of diarrhea, abdominal pain, bloating, and urgency. Unlike other digestive conditions, IBS-D does not cause permanent damage to the intestines, but its symptoms significantly impact daily life.

The Role of Diet in Managing IBS-D


Diet plays a crucial role in managing IBS-D symptoms. Certain foods can trigger or worsen symptoms, while others may help alleviate discomfort. An individualized dietary approach often serves as the first line of treatment alongside medications and lifestyle modifications.

Key Components of an IBS-D Diet PDF



An effective IBS-D diet PDF typically covers several essential areas:

1. Low FODMAP Diet Guidelines


The Low FODMAP diet is considered one of the most effective dietary strategies for IBS-D management. FODMAPs are fermentable oligosaccharides, disaccharides, monosaccharides, and polyols that can cause gas, bloating, and diarrhea.


  • Foods to avoid or limit: wheat, onions, garlic, apples, pears, milk, and certain sweeteners.

  • Foods to include: low FODMAP fruits, vegetables, grains, and proteins.



2. Identifying and Eliminating Triggers


A good IBS-D diet PDF helps identify personal triggers through elimination and reintroduction phases.

3. Incorporating Fiber Wisely


Fiber can be a double-edged sword; some types alleviate symptoms, while others worsen them.


  • Soluble fiber (e.g., oats, carrots) may help regulate bowel movements.

  • Insoluble fiber (e.g., whole grains, nuts) may irritate the gut in some individuals.



4. Hydration and Fluid Intake


Adequate hydration is vital, especially since diarrhea can lead to dehydration.
